<div class="job-description w-richtext"><p>Founded in 2005, iam8bit is a creative production emporium that has quietly redefined the entertainment industry, time and time again. Collaborating with a plethora of partners and narrative-busting IPs, iam8bit punctuates the importance of engaging with fans directly. By creating the video game industry's very first community events, the company injected the idea of experiential immersion into game and film marketing. iam8bit also played a crucial role in the vinyl renaissance, minting its first record in 2010, and is the industry leader in premium physical editions of top-tier games. </p>
<p>In 2020, iam8bit evolved into financing and publishing games, including the smash hit Escape Academy and its upcoming sequel; Petal Runner, a love letter to Game Boy Color-era RPGs; and the chill vibes simulator Simpler Times. The company is based in Los Angeles and co-owned/co-creatively directed by Jon M. Gibson and Amanda White.</p>
<p>Iam8bit Presents is looking for a <strong>Producer </strong>to help drive the delivery of our slate of games. This is a key role project managing multiple games, including establishing requirements, managing schedules, and facilitating communications with development teams and vendors. We’re looking for someone who will never compromise quality, continuously inspect and improve processes, and promote sustainable, realistic game development. We are a small team and looking for a resourceful problem-solver who is highly communicative, agile, and creative! This position reports to the Head of Games. </p>
<p> </p>
<p><strong>RESPONSIBILITIES </strong></p>
<ul>
<li>Act as the central point of communication for development teams, providing regular updates to stakeholders and addressing any concerns or roadblocks.</li>
<li>Manage timelines for milestones, artifacts, and deadlines across publishing and development.</li>
<li>Proactively manage and reduce project risks throughout production, using project management methodologies.</li>
<li>Use creative problem solving skills to unblock developers and navigate through ambiguity. </li>
<li>Proactively identify areas for improvement by helping to develop and refine templates and frameworks used for publishing, production, and release management. </li>
<li>Provide constructive feedback on game quality and player experience, representing the voice of the player to guide the team toward necessary iteration. </li>
<li>Procure vendors for publishing services such as localization and porting, serving as a liaison between them and development teams.</li>
<li>Support release of games, DLC, patches, and updates by ensuring all required checks and approvals for release are completed.</li>
<li>Work with QA to help triage issues, maintain priority lists and support planning of hotfixes, patches, and content releases. </li>
